JCB 714 & 718 ADT Tier 3 Service Manual (9813/0550-3)
This official JCB factory service manual delivers comprehensive repair, maintenance, and diagnostic information for the JCB 714 and 718 Articulated Dump Trucks (ADT) equipped with Tier 3 JCB Dieselmax engines. It includes advanced hydraulic, transmission, and electrical CAN-bus system data, providing essential guidance for professional technicians, ensuring precise service operations and Tier 3 compliance.
Model Covers:
JCB 714 ADT – from Serial No. 1304500
JCB 718 ADT – from Serial No. 1304600
Note: Applies to Tier 3 Dieselmax-powered ADTs featuring revised torque specifications, upgraded hydraulic systems, and CAN-bus electrical architecture for enhanced diagnostics and control precision.
